Output 21f1c4c640ee37737524dae06516c4d4a05953ab27d13b2d1da236f04a6ecc89:40

value
33254
script pubkey
OP_0 OP_PUSHBYTES_20 a4cb6ce2ff880b1d7b7461395b6270f67fca3ea8
address
bc1q5n9kechl3q9367m5vyu4kcns7elu504g9mdk9j
transaction
21f1c4c640ee37737524dae06516c4d4a05953ab27d13b2d1da236f04a6ecc89